Assam down town University (AdtU) has entered into a formal academic collaboration with Deloitte India, in association with Zell Education, to offer an industry-integrated BBA in FinTech programme. This brings together AdtU's NAAC A+ academic infrastructure, Deloitte's global professional expertise, and Zell Education's curriculum strengths - creating a programme that prepares students for the financial services industry of tomorrow.
Students acquire working knowledge of digital payments, blockchain, AI-powered financial tools, regulatory compliance, and investment technology - delivered through 12 modules spanning 540+ hours of immersive instruction. The programme also includes a Internship and ongoing Live Teaching & Mentorship from Deloitte professionals, giving students continuous industry exposure - not just a one-off guest session.

The BBA in FinTech is a full-time, three-year undergraduate programme that combines business administration foundations with a structured specialisation in Financial Technology. The curriculum moves well beyond a conventional BBA integrating Deloitte-influenced content across 12 specialist modules covering digital payments, AI-driven credit systems, blockchain, RegTech compliance, and FinTech entrepreneurship.
Across 540+ hours of structured learning, students engage with case-based projects, market simulations, hands-on AI and blockchain applications, hackathons, and a Capstone project where they build and pitch a FinTech startup. Students also benefit from a Internship and ongoing Live Teaching & Mentorship from Deloitte professionals throughout the programme.
